The Court made the following common order:
Challenging the order dated 08.05.2024 in LA. No.379 of 2024 and the docket order dated 10.05.2024 in O.S. No.409 of 2015 on the file of learned VII Additional District Judge, Vijayawada, CRP Nos.1171 and 1172 of 2024 respectively are filed.
Heard Sri M.R.K.Chakravarthy, learned counsel appearing for the petitioner and Sri V.V.Ravi Prasad, learned counsel appearing for the respondent. 2.
When the matter came up for hearing, both the learned $\overline{3}$ . counsel across the bar submitted that they have no objection for allowing the CRPs and setting aside the impugned orders passed in I.A. No.379 of 2024 in O.S. No.409 of 2015 and O.S. No.409 of 2015 respectively. They further submitted that consequent to allowing the CRPs, the defendant in O.S. No.409 of 2015 may be permitted to submit certified copies of Urban Land Ceiling Proceedings vide C.C. No.1405/76 and proceed with the trial.
Recording the above submissions of both the learned counsels, these CRPs are allowed by setting aside the impugned orders in LA. No:379 of 2024 and the docket order in O.S. No.409 of 2015 respectively. As a consequence, the petitioner herein i.e., defendant is permitted to produce certified copies of Urban Land Ceiling Proceedings vide C.C. No.1405/76 before the trial court and proceed with the trial accordingly. No costs. As a sequel, interlocutory applications pending, if any, in this case shall stand closed.
